Call Preparation Questions

Customers, Marketing, Pricing, Competition

Does the company charge clients based on volume or a minimum fixed fee? - Fixed fees are becoming more common.

How many card accounts are on file? What percentage is active versus inactive? - Processors can have millions of accounts; active accounts are important to merchant processors.

What is the company’s discount rate? - Prices average 2 percent, but are higher for online transactions.

Does the company use an Independent Sales Organization (ISO)? How large is it? - Merchant processors typically sell using ISOs as well as a direct sales force.

What processors are the company’s primary competitors? - First Data Corporation, NOVA Information Systems, and Total System Services are large competitors.

Competitive Landscape

Demand is driven by consumer spending. The profitability of individual companies depends on efficient operations, as services are sold largely based on cost. Large companies have big economies of scale in processing and can provide more services; small companies can compete by specializing in industries and providing custom services. The business is highly automated and capital-intensive: average annual revenue per employee is about $225,000.

Business Challenges

CRITICAL ISSUES

Revenues Affected by Consumer Spending - Industry revenues are closely tied to the number of credit card transactions, which depend on consumer spending. For example, during the early 2000s recession, transaction revenues for major industry player First Data were flat, versus 20 percent increases in other years. Over a third of all consumer retail purchases are made using credit cards.

Financial Consolidation Pushes Industry Consolidation - Bank consolidations often result in lost business for a specific processor. An acquiring bank will usually transfer the credit card portfolio of the acquired bank to its own processor. As consolidation continues, the processing industry will become more concentrated.
